Understanding the Fear of Driving Tests
Fear of driving tests, frequently classified as "test stress and anxiety," can originate from various sources. These consist of:
- Fear of Failure: Many candidates are scared of stopping working, which can result in deep feelings of inadequacy or pity.
- Pressure from Others: Expectations from family, friends, or peers can ramp up stress levels and intensify anxiety.
- Absence of Experience: Novice chauffeurs may feel frightened by the complexity of the test, specifically in unknown driving conditions.
- Unfavorable Past Experiences: Previous failures or negative experiences, such as mishaps, can contribute considerably to test stress and anxiety.
Recognizing the origin of driving test anxiety permits candidates to resolve their fears in a useful manner.

The Driving Test Breakdown
Understanding what to anticipate during the driving test can assist reduce stress and anxiety. Below is a summed up table laying out the common components of a driving test:
Component | Description |
---|---|
Pre-Drive Check | Candidates may need to show understanding of lorry controls and safety checks before driving. |
Basic Control | Evaluation of basic driving maneuvers, such as steering, a1 füHrerschein Beantragen braking, and signaling. |
Roadway Navigation | Prospects must show their ability to follow roadway rules, navigate intersections, and handle traffic circumstances. |
Parking Skills | Candidates are needed to properly perform parking maneuvers, such as parallel parking or parking in a lot. |
Post-Drive Assessment | A conversation with the inspector covering strengths and weaknesses observed throughout the test. |
Frequently asked question Section
Q1: Is it normal to feel nervous before a driving test?
Yes, it is entirely normal to experience anxiety before a driving test. Numerous people share these sensations, called test anxiety.
Q2: How can I calm my nerves on the day of the test?
Engaging in mindfulness practices, such as meditation or deep breathing, can assist relieve nerves. Additionally, arriving early to the testing site to season to the environment can be helpful.
Q3: What if I fail my driving test?
Stopping working the driving test is not an unusual incident. It is vital to view it as a knowing chance. Show on the feedback supplied by the inspector and concentrate on the areas that need enhancement before retaking the test.
Q4: Can taking driving lessons minimize stress and anxiety?
Yes, expert driving lessons can increase self-confidence and skills, reducing general stress and anxiety about the test. Instructors can supply valuable insights into the test format and expectations.
Q5: How lots of times can I retake the driving test?
The variety of efforts to retake a driving test differs by place. Many jurisdictions offer specific standards relating to retaking tests, consisting of waiting durations and additional costs.
